Going into deeper questions what about an alcoholic? Growing up I knew an alcoholic who was a cousin to our neighbor. He would stay sober enough to work and made good money. But he would drink until he passed out. As soon as the man got paid before he bought his booze he stopped at an old country store buying up food mainly ten pounds of bologna, fat back, bread, beans, and potatos. The grocer said where are you going to put this meat it will spoil. He said to the grocer don't worry it will be OK..

No one knew why he was buying all that food. He never told them. {I found this out later that he didn't tell anyone}. But I did see him deliver it many times when I was a kid. a He would take the food & go to his cousins home who's husband had left her and nine kids to go get drunk and womanize for his fun. By that point when the womans cousin got there he would be quite drunk. Guess where the food was going? I know it's true I saw it not once but every week almost. I know now that no one knew the man was doing this except few people and not even the grocer knew what he did with it although the grocer knew him well. Everyone in the county did.

My future wife living in a community almost 20 miles away saw him buying it before at that store and at the time she didn't know either till I told her years later where it all went. This was long before I met her.

Everyone knew that man though. He had been a deacon and had a family his kids were grown. An event happened he just could not handle or overcome the grief of and began drinking not for the fun of a drunk but to numb himself from a memory he could not get over. It was simply the loss of his wife.

Oddly enough another man lived next door to the woman and nine kids. He too was a deacon but very active in his church. He would ask the mom every Saturday if the kids wanted to go to church the next day. The one thing he refused to do? Spare them so much as a bucket of water from his well. The mother did not have running water and water had to be carried in by the kids thus she relied on others to allow her to get water from their well.

She had two wells close enough to help her. The deacons and someone elses who always let them have water and if possible what else they needed. Which man would you want to be on judgement day? The alcoholic or the deacon? Which one would be most rewarded?

From what I gather years later the alcoholic sobered up and got his life back on track from what I saw in his Obit. He really was a kind man who meant no one no harm. The other deacon was one neighborhood men had to watch around women because of wandering eyes.
